A Journey Through Spirituality and Scenic Splendor

Nestled in the heart of the Kumaon region in Uttarakhand, the Adi Kailash Yatra takes travelers to the ancient mountain that mirrors Mount Kailash’s divine aura. Unlike its Tibetan counterpart, Adi Kailash is approachable via a well-maintained road that winds through some of India’s most picturesque landscapes. It’s a journey that intertwines spirituality with breathtaking natural beauty, ensuring that every mile of the road becomes a meditative experience.

Pilgrims often recount how this journey transforms them. The pristine air, the sound of rustling leaves, and the sight of snow-capped peaks lend an otherworldly vibe to the trek. The holy Om Parvat, with its naturally formed “Om” symbol, and the Parvati Sarovar, glistening like a jewel under the sun, amplify the spiritual energy of the region.

Experiences Along the Way

A road trip to Adi Kailash is as much about the journey as it is about the destination. The route is dotted with picturesque villages, ancient temples, and natural wonders that make the experience unforgettable. Stops at Narayan Ashram and the Kali Temple at Gunji offer spiritual reprieves. At Gunji, travelers can often hear chants and bells echoing across the valleys, creating a divine symphony.

For nature lovers, the trip offers unparalleled vistas of dense forests, gushing rivers, and towering peaks. The mighty Kali River, which flows alongside the road in many stretches, serves as a constant reminder of the region’s vibrancy and life. And then there’s the Om Parvat, a sacred marvel where the natural formation of the “Om” symbol feels like a direct communication from the divine.

Weather and Travel Tips

The weather in the Himalayan region can be unpredictable, but the months of May to October remain the most favorable for the yatra. As you prepare for 2025, ensure that you’re equipped for sudden changes in temperature. Lightweight jackets, sturdy trekking shoes, and an emergency medical kit are essentials for the trip.

Road journeys to Adi Kailash often come with their own set of challenges. Be prepared for long hours of travel, and consider packing snacks, water, and a power bank to keep your devices charged for capturing those once-in-a-lifetime views.
